Eight days into the Apollo 11 mission and the coverage by the Chicago Tribune has declined drastically. Despite competing stories, the headline of today’s newspaper is still dedicated to the mission. To celebrate the 52nd anniversary of the Apollo 11 mission, we are sharing images of coverage by the Chicago Tribune that was published each day throughout the duration of the mission.
Moon Men Will Visit Chicago
Not only has the focus turned to the return of the crew to Earth, but news that the crew will visit Chicago soon after they return. The crew of Apollo 11 would end up taking a Goodwill tour around the world.
Mission Coverage and News
Mission news today was dedicated to more of the initial findings about the Moon that resulted in experiments done by astronauts. Additional astronaut moments in space were shared, including how the astronauts prepare meals. A funny quip about the state of the stock market and astronaut Armstrong’s reaction also made the news today.
Spaceflight Snippets
Comics, addresses from religious leaders, and speculation about how Armstrong came up with his first words spoken on the Moon are here.
